Doug Sherrill to run for Dist. 9 State Representative

LUMPKIN COUNTY, Ga. – Former Lumpkin County Commissioner Doug Sherill has announced that he is a candidate for District 9 State Representative.

“After careful consideration and prayer, I am officially announcing my candidacy for the Georgia State House of Representatives, 9th District,” Sherill said. “My wife and kids support me 100% in this endeavor and that was really my deciding factor.

“It seems my life has been one of servant leadership. In high school I was selected to Boys State and that whetted my taste for the political arena. I obtained a Bachelor of Science majoring in political science from North Georgia College and completed my education obtaining a Master’s degree in Public Administration from the University of North Georgia.

“As a husband and father, I have served our community in many various ways. As a coach, pastor, educator, and serving as Lumpkin County’s District 1 Commissioner, I understand public service. My most recent endeavor has been kick-starting a program at the UNG Gainesville Campus for Professional Land Surveyors as a lecturer in Legal Aspects and Geomatics.

“I believe I can provide Lumpkin and Dawson counties the leadership and conservative principles needed in this tough political climate. I am not new to politics and most of you are well acquainted with my conservative record. I have strong relationships with our current elected officials and am well acquainted with the needs of our community. As a county commissioner I played a key role in establishing budgets that cutting taxes.

“I am a strong supporter of our law enforcement and fire department. I unashamedly supported our sheriff while commissioner and the needs of our deputies. I listened and supported our other elected officials as we carefully maintained a conservative budget. We worked to improve economic development and voted to allocate funding for the Development Authority and facilitated bringing business to Lumpkin County.

“Our most distinguishing vote came when we helped to provide our local government systematic raises that they so desperately needed. I also was a strong proponent of seeking state funding for our new library. I am proud of my record as a commissioner and intend to take my abilities to the next level and stand for our community in Atlanta. I look forward to earning your support and vote. I want to run to be the voice in the state house that will best represent our community and its needs.”

Doug Sherill’s biography:

Current Owner of LDP Land Development Professionals as a Professional Land Surveyor and Land Planner

Louisiana Baptist University in pastoral ministry

North Georgia College BS in Political Science/Business

University of North Georgia MPA Public Administration

Ordained Minister

Served on the Georgia Board of Health District 2

Vice Chair of the Lumpkin County Board of Commissioners

ACCG Certified County Commissioner

Geomatics Lecturer at the University of North Georgia

Vice Chair of Resource and Environment ACCG

Served on the ACCG Policy Council

Former Lumpkin County Surveyor

Subject matter expert in Georgia Land Surveying

Leadership Lumpkin 2015
